The hexadecimal color code #CDD10C corresponds to the code RGB( 205, 209, 12 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,80 level), green (at 0,82 level) and blue (at 0,05 level). Its brightness is 43% and its saturation is 89%. It is composed of red at 48%, green at 49% and blue at 2%.

The complementary color #322EF3 is the color exactly opposite to #CDD10C on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

Uses of #CDD10C in CSS

When using #CDD10C as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#CDD10C as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
